In order to reduce panic attacks, it is crucial that you sleep for 6 hours each night. If you are sleeping the proper amount, you will wake rested and refreshed. If you are not exhausted, you will be able to keep your stress under control more easily. The more in control you are feeling, then there is less likelihood you will give in to your panic.

If you are prone to panic attacks, avoid excessive use of alcohol. Alcohol is a depressant, and it can put you in a bad mood. Alcohol will have a negative impact if you have a panic attack and could lead you to suicidal thoughts. Many medications that may be prescribed to treat your panic attacks, cannot be consumed with alcohol and can have serious side effects if combined.

The first part of battling anxiety and your panic attacks is to identify all the different signs and symptoms of your specific panic attacks. If you can recognize the symptoms, then you can better prepare yourself for an attack. Knowing when an attack will happen is useful.

Focus on exhaling when you are having a panic attack. You may find yourself inhaling quickly, and that is okay. It is actually very common when someone is in panic mode. The essential part is to hold the air and exhale at a slow, controlled rate.
